chromedriver-win64_117.0.5897.3.z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
【标题与描述解析】 标题"chromedriver-win64_117.0.5897.3.zip"指的是一个适用于64位Windows操作系统的Chrome浏览器驱动程序的压缩包,其版本号为117.0.5897.3。这个驱动是用于自动化测试工具,如Selenium,来控制Google Chrome浏览器进行网页自动化操作。 【知识点详解】 1. **ChromeDriver**: ChromeDriver是Selenium WebDriver的一个实现,专门用于与Google Chrome浏览器交互。它是一个独立的服务器,遵循WebDriver协议,使得自动化测试脚本能够发送命令到Chrome浏览器,并接收浏览器执行这些命令后的响应。 2. **Selenium WebDriver**: Selenium是一个开源的Web应用程序自动化测试框架,支持多种编程语言,如Java、Python、C#等。WebDriver是Selenium的一部分,提供了一种标准化的API,允许开发者通过编写代码来控制浏览器的行为,进行端到端的测试。 3. **64位系统兼容性**: "win64"表明这个版本的ChromeDriver是为64位Windows操作系统设计的。在32位系统上无法运行,因此在部署前需要确保系统架构匹配。 4. **版本号117.0.5897.3**: 软件版本号表示该驱动的更新迭代,通常每次更新会修复已知问题、增强性能或增加新功能。确保使用与当前Chrome浏览器版本相匹配的ChromeDriver版本是至关重要的,因为不兼容的版本可能导致自动化测试失败。 5. **自动化测试**: 自动化测试是软件开发过程中的关键环节,可以显著提高测试效率和质量。使用ChromeDriver和Selenium,开发者或测试工程师可以创建脚本来模拟用户在浏览器上的各种操作,例如点击按钮、填写表单、导航页面等,从而实现自动化测试。 6. **安装与配置**: 解压缩"chromedriver-win64_117.0.5897.3.zip"后,通常将`chromedriver.exe`文件放置在系统的PATH环境变量中,或者在测试脚本中指定其完整路径,以便Selenium能够找到并使用它。 7. **错误处理与兼容性**: 在使用ChromeDriver时,可能会遇到版本不匹配、权限问题、网络连接问题等。为确保顺利运行,应检查并解决这些问题,同时监控日志输出以排查错误。 8. **持续集成(CI)**: 在持续集成环境中,例如Jenkins、Travis CI等,自动化的测试用例经常运行,此时ChromeDriver是不可或缺的组件,确保每次构建时都能进行浏览器兼容性测试。 9. **跨平台测试**: 虽然这里讨论的是Windows版本,但ChromeDriver也有对应MacOS和Linux的版本,这使得测试可以在不同操作系统上进行,确保应用的广泛兼容性。 "chromedriver-win64_117.0.5897.3.zip"是自动化测试的关键工具,尤其对于依赖Google Chrome浏览器的Web应用程序。正确安装、配置和使用这个驱动可以极大地提升测试效率,确保软件质量。
- 1
- 粉丝: 6035
- 资源: 7290
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- python图片转字符
- 【java毕业设计】客户关系管理系统源码(ssm+mysql+说明文档).zip
- 【java毕业设计】酒店客房预定管理系统源码(ssm+mysql+说明文档+LW).zip
- 【java毕业设计】教师业务数据统计与分析系统源码(ssm+mysql+说明文档).zip
- cp105b,cp205,cp205w,cp215,cp215w寿命重置工具,解决091-402
- 【java毕业设计】健身房管理系统源码(ssm+mysql+说明文档).zip
- py test for self
- ui-auto test for self
- 【java毕业设计】基于推荐算法的图书购物网站源码(ssm+mysql+说明文档+LW).zip
- appium test for self